Re: Groundhog Hunting (Do I need a License?)
ok. Do I understand this correctly.
I need a hunting license to sit in a farmers field and just shoot the groundhogs because they are a pest?
If so, I will go get one. I been doing this my whole life and didnt know this if its true, and I thank you all for enlightening me on this, because im not a hunter. I dont hunt deer, squirrel, or anything like that. I kill pests for fun.
I guess I been a law breaker. I will fix that ASAP (if I really need to)
Oh, and when is groundhog season and what colors should I wear? Would just an orange cap suffice?Last edited by MicroMonkey; June 23rd, 2011 at 07:12 PM.

Re: Groundhog Hunting (Do I need a License?)
Welcome to the PA Game Commission. Unfortunately you are supposed to have a license to eliminate some pesky woodchucks. Obviously woodchuck poaching isn't high on the Commission's list of things to cite people for...but I'm sure if a warden saw you without a license they would make you pay a fine.
Orange cap is all you need for groundhog."Improvise. Adapt. Overcome."
